Transaction 364627737fa4dc77845de07adb8977639e0ae265e80a6a89bcda8f9266988f7d
1 Input
1 Output
-
364627737fa4dc77845de07adb8977639e0ae265e80a6a89bcda8f9266988f7d:0
- value
- 278653106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 698d556b25f66fb3a96124cf50aaa67542f70705 OP_EQUAL
- address
- 3BK8BinUmEvp1coNuXmJxPMrUY23ENv3sR